IPROMO 2016 Summer School: Managing mountain resources and diversities - the role of protected areas

Ormea, Italy
From: 08.07.2016 to: 18.07.2016

The ninth International Programme on Research and Training on Sustainable Management of Mountain Areas (IPROMO), organized by the Mountain Partnership Secretariat and the University of Turin, will focus on “Managing mountain resources and diversities: the role of protected areas”. It will focus on several aspects that contribute to the productive management of mountain protected areas, ranging from sustainable environment conservation to governance rights, income generation and food security.

There are a number of planned field excursions to explore different examples of mountain resource management in protected areas, soil and geology valorization. The interrelations between climate change and other global challenges and mountain protected areas will be discussed during the course and working groups will be formed, allowing participants to share their knowledge and build a network of experts. Lectures will be led by experts from the UN system, universities, international organizations and NGOs.

About 30 professionals will be admitted to the course and preference will be given to participants coming from countries and organizations which are members of the Mountain Partnership.
